Description

The Seamstress is a gripping tale of adventure, love, and war, set against the backdrop of Spain's tumultuous 1936. At just 12 years old, Sira Quiroga is apprenticed to a Madrid dressmaker, but her life takes a dramatic turn when she falls passionately in love and flees with her seductive lover. Betrayed and left penniless, Sira finds herself in Morocco, where she must rely on her one true skill - sewing - to survive.

As civil war engulfs Spain, Sira is drawn back into the country, lured by the promise of work and a chance to use her talents to support the expat elite and their German friends. But as Europe teeters on the brink of war, Sira becomes embroiled in a shadowy world of espionage, where love, intrigue, and betrayal threaten to destroy her at every turn.
